Description

Methanamine, n-Methyl-, Polymer With Ammonia And (Chloromethyl)Oxirane CAS NO 52722-38-0 is a specialized cationic polymer, specifically a polyamine-epichlorohydrin resin, known for its high charge density and reactivity. This compound is valued for its exceptional performance as a flocculant, retention aid, and wet-strength agent in demanding industrial processes. It is a critical raw material for manufacturers in the paper and pulp, water treatment, and textile industries seeking to improve process efficiency and product performance.

Application

  • Paper and Pulp Manufacturing: Primary use as a wet-strength resin to significantly improve the dry and wet tensile strength of paper products like towels, tissues, and packaging board.
  • Wastewater Treatment: Acts as a highly effective cationic flocculant for clarifying industrial and municipal wastewater by agglomerating suspended solids and organic matter.
  • Retention and Drainage Aid: Enhances the retention of fine particles and fillers in papermaking, improving sheet formation and reducing raw material costs.
  • Textile Processing: Used as a fixing agent and dye retention aid to improve color fastness and reduce dye migration.
  • Sugar Refining: Employed as a clarifier to remove impurities and colorants from sugar syrups during the refining process.
  • Oil & Gas Industry: Functions as a clay stabilizer and fluid loss control additive in drilling mud formulations.

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ry, well-ventilated area at temperatures between 15°C and 25°C (59°F and 77°F). This product is h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ive) and should be kept away from strong oxidizing agents and acids. For long-term storage, ensure containers are sealed to prevent moisture absorption and skin formation.
